Output 04d43ca953b5ae6a8fc213283e632529bcef958362558bc7eb2de7f4bd94fb7e:4

value
683698
script pubkey
OP_0 OP_PUSHBYTES_20 aebc445179787050a0616898fe1d90653b593d55
address
bc1q467yg5te0pc9pgrpdzv0u8vsv5a4j024ej3w73
transaction
04d43ca953b5ae6a8fc213283e632529bcef958362558bc7eb2de7f4bd94fb7e
spent
true